Handover — Vexler partner SFTP drop

Ownership moves to you today. Drop runs hourly from Vexler's end into the intake bucket via the relay host. Watch for zero-byte files; their exporter flakes on Mondays. Creds live in the ops vault, path noted in the runbook. Vault auto-seals after 48h idle. Support escalations go to the on-call rotation, not me. If the vault is sealed when you need it, unseal with the recovery passphrase below.

recovery phrase for tadug-fafof: zorwyn-kasion

= Building Access: New Turnstiles =

Heads up, new starters — the lobby turnstiles at Fenholt Court were upgraded last month, so ignore anything the old induction video says about swipe cards. The new gates from Gatewise read your badge from about 30cm away; no need to tap. If the gate flashes amber, step back and try again rather than pushing through (ask Dev in Facilities how he knows). Until your permanent badge arrives, use the temporary pass code below.

turnstile pass: bdg-QZV-3

## Environments: Thimblewick cold starts

Heads up before any release: Thimblewick's serverless handlers cold-start noticeably slower in the pre-prod environment than in prod, mostly because pre-prod skips the warm-pool. That's intentional — it keeps costs down — but it means your smoke tests will look slower than reality. Prod keeps a small pool of pre-warmed handlers per region. The warm-pool behavior is controlled by the configuration values below, which should match in every promoted environment.

service settings:
[ulair]
team = praath
access_code = ac_06d704
owner = wenix.ulair
host = ulair.qirvancorp.corp
port = 9200
peer = sorys.nelvronet.internal
salt = 2668132c
pin = 9140

# Artifact Signing — LocaleForge date-format packs

Every localized date-format pack built by LocaleForge must be signed before it ships to the formatting service. The pipeline signs packs automatically on merge; manual re-signing is only needed when you edit a pack's metadata by hand. Verification happens at load time, so an unsigned pack is silently skipped. All packs are verified against the key below.

signing key of fajop-tahop = bky9_qdL6xeDv7